Hyderabad: The Hyderabad Metropolitan Development Authority on Monday released a notification for the auction of leftover and gifted plots. Citizens can participate in the e-auction from April 9 to April 12. The bidding process will be held from 10.30 am to 12.30 pm and from 2 pm to 5 pm on the four days. 72 plots will be auctioned per day. 

The tender document will be available to download from midnight of April 7 at www.mstcecommerce.com, a third-party website maintained by the Centre.  
Rs 10,000 is the registration fee for the e-auction. Those who end up getting plots in the auction can pay the bid amount in instalments. 25 percent of the plot value must be paid within a week from the auction, and the remaining amount must be paid within 60 days. 

The HMDA is looking to earn about Rs 300 crore through the auction of plots. HMDA authorities said of the 229 plots being auctioned, 146 were located in HMDA-developed layouts.
